Output a679423c8ccd29bdb61f5b06ef9f8a4b97fa9180b88a087ada532a9eacd76519:31

value
599737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88c5a3966241dea50ab47610f8f455fddaea1bf8 OP_EQUAL
address
3EACaqDPUkUPAgJy5sioHRUqiaLyAYKEEA
transaction
a679423c8ccd29bdb61f5b06ef9f8a4b97fa9180b88a087ada532a9eacd76519
spent
true